Graveside services for Margaret Sue Cox Taylor, 80, will be held Wednesday, February 24, 2021 at 2 p.m. at Garden of Memories Cemetery in Paducah with Trey Morgan officiating. Burial will follow under the direction of Johnson Funeral Home. Visitation will be held Tuesday, February 23, 2021 from 6-8 p.m. at Johnson Funeral Home.
She passed away February 21, 2021 in Childress.
Margaret Sue Cox was born October 2, 1940 in Paducah to Ovid Eland Cox, Jr. and Hazel Madolin Johnson. She was an amazing singer with some telling her she sounded like Patsy Cline. She was a nurse by trade and loved taking care of people. She was very good at it and served as a nurse in both Paducah and Childress. She was also a nanny and loved it. She was a nanny for the Bass family of Dallas at one time. She also loved to read.
She was preceded in death by her parents, a grandson, Christopher Hendry and a great grandson, Trey Vasquez.
Survivors include a brother, Earl Bruce Cox; a sister, Judy Sunday; two sons, Donald Hendry and wife, Paula and Bruce Shane Hendry and wife, Lancy; two daughters, Helen Powell and husband, Douglas, and Crystal Taylor and husband, Chance Goodman; 12 grandchildren, 20 great grandchildren and numerous nieces, nephews and extended family members.
The family suggests memorials to the Alzheimer’s Association.
